History

The history of Shabla Town Center is deeply intertwined with the broader narrative of Shabla itself, a settlement dating back to ancient times. Archaeological findings in the broader Shabla area suggest human presence since the Eneolithic period, with significant Thracian and Roman influences. The town center, as it exists today, grew organically around its central square and main arteries, reflecting centuries of development as a regional hub for agriculture, fishing, and trade. During the Ottoman era, Shabla maintained its importance, serving as a key point along the Black Sea coast. The late 19th and early 20th centuries saw further modernization, with the establishment of administrative buildings, schools, and essential infrastructure that shaped the current layout of the town center. Its resilience through various historical periods, from Byzantine rule to the Bulgarian Revival and beyond, has imbued the district with a rich heritage and a strong sense of identity. Despite its tranquil atmosphere today, Shabla Town Center echoes with the stories of generations who have called this beautiful corner of Bulgaria home, making it a place of both historical depth and contemporary charm.

Property market

The property market in Shabla Town Center offers an attractive proposition for both residents and investors, primarily characterized by its affordability and potential for appreciation. The district mainly features older, solid Bulgarian houses, some in need of renovation, alongside a growing number of newly built or modernized apartments. Traditional houses, often with spacious yards, typically range from EUR 30,000 to EUR 80,000 depending on condition, size, and proximity to central amenities. Fully renovated houses or those with significant land command prices from EUR 90,000 to EUR 150,000. Apartments in the town center, ranging from studio to two-bedroom units, can be found between EUR 25,000 and EUR 70,000, with newer builds on the higher end. Rental yields in Shabla Town Center are modest but stable, generally ranging from 4% to 6% annually, particularly for properties catering to long-term residents or seasonal tourists during the summer. The market is supported by local demand, growing interest from Bulgarian holidaymakers, and a steady trickle of international buyers seeking an authentic, value-for-money coastal experience. With ongoing regional development and infrastructure improvements, properties here present a promising long-term investment opportunity.

Living in Shabla Town Center

Life in Shabla Town Center is defined by its laid-back rhythm and strong community ties. Residents enjoy the convenience of having everything within walking distance: local bakeries offering fresh 'banitsa', small grocery stores, pharmacies, and the weekly market where local produce and goods are sold. Several authentic Bulgarian restaurants and cafes provide welcoming spots for socializing and enjoying traditional cuisine. Public transport primarily consists of regional bus connections, making it easy to reach nearby villages, the famous Shabla Lighthouse, and the broader Dobrich region. While not a bustling metropolis, the town center provides all essential services, including a post office and medical facilities, ensuring a comfortable daily life. Weekends often involve leisurely strolls, visits to the nearby Black Sea beaches, or engaging in local cultural events. The emphasis here is on simplicity, community, and enjoying the natural beauty that surrounds this charming coastal town.
